681130-51-8,26873-25-6,165668-39-3,164264-97-5,173340-46-0,500588-56-7 Supplier | CHEMBETA.COM
CMO CDMO service. CHEMBETA.COM supply 681130-51-8,26873-25-6,165668-39-3,164264-97-5,173340-46-0,500588-56-7 and related compounds.
173340-46-0 500588-56-7 26873-25-6 164264-97-5 681130-51-8 165668-39-3